  • Gamma irradiation of poly(alkyl methacrylates)
    作者:Roger K. Graham
    DOI:10.1002/pol.1959.1203813318
    日期:1959.7
    of poly(alkyl methacrylates) were prepared from monomer of high purity and subjected to gamma irradiation. Gelation in the n-alkyl series was detected for poly (n-heptyl methacrylate) at 15 Mreps; gel was detected at lower doses as the length of the alkyl group increased. No gelation was found on irradiation of poly (sec-alkyl methacrylates) to relatively high doses; poly(sec-nonyl methacrylate) remained
    一系列聚(甲基丙烯酸烷基酯)由高纯度单体制备并经受伽马辐射。对于聚(甲基丙烯酸正庚酯),在 15 Mreps 下检测到正烷基系列中的凝胶化;随着烷基长度的增加,在较低剂量下检测到凝胶。聚(甲基丙烯酸仲烷基酯)照射到较高剂量时未发现凝胶化;聚(甲基丙烯酸仲壬酯)在 40 Mreps 辐照后仍可溶解。讨论了与早期聚(丙烯酸烷基酯)辐照工作的相关性。
  • [EN] METHOD FOR PREPARING (METH)ACRYLATES OF BIOBASED ALCOHOLS AND POLYMERS THEREOF<br/>[FR] PROCÉDÉ DE PRÉPARATION DE (MÉTH)ACRYLATES DE BIOALCOOLS, ET POLYMÈRES DE CEUX-CI
    申请人:3M INNOVATIVE PROPERTIES CO
    公开号:WO2014143690A1
    公开(公告)日:2014-09-18
    Polymers, particularly those used in pressure-sensitive adhesives, are prepared from a mixture of structural isomers of a secondary alkyl (meth)acrylate monomer. The mixture is made by dehydrating a C2-C22 alcohol using a continuous process to form a mixture of olefins, and reacting (meth)acrylic acid with at least some of the mixture of olefins in the presence of an acid catalyst. The adhesives are characterized by exhibiting an overall balance of adhesive and cohesive characteristics.
    聚合物,尤其是用于压敏胶粘剂的聚合物,是由二级烷基(甲基)丙烯酸酯单体的结构异构体混合物制备而成。该混合物通过脱水C2-C22醇的连续过程形成一种烯烃混合物,并在酸催化剂存在下将(甲基)丙烯酸与至少部分烯烃混合物反应而制得。这种胶粘剂的特点是具有整体平衡的粘附和内聚特性。

  • RESIN COMPOSITION, AND MOLDED ARTICLE AND PIPE FORMED FROM SAID COMPOSITION
    申请人:Mitsui Chemicals, Inc.
    公开号:EP3366722A1
    公开(公告)日:2018-08-29
    The purpose of the present invention is to provide: a vinyl chloride resin composition having exceptional impact resistance, processability, and heat resistance. The present invention provides: a resin composition that contains 3-15 parts by mass of a rubber-based impact-absorbing material and 0.1-10 parts by mass of a modified olefin wax per 100 parts by mass of a vinyl chloride resin. This resin composition satisfies the following requirements (I)-(III). (I) The chlorine content of the vinyl chloride resin is 55-75% by mass. (II) The glass transition temperature (Tg) in differential scanning calorimetry (DSC) of the rubber-based impact-absorbing material (B) is 0°C or lower. (III) The modified olefin wax contains at least one polar group selected from halogens and carboxylic acid derivatives, and the polar group content is within the range of 0.1-50% by mass.
    本发明的目的是提供:一种具有优异抗冲击性、加工性和耐热性的氯乙烯树脂组合物。本发明提供了:一种树脂组合物,每 100 份质量的氯乙烯树脂中含有 3-15 份质量的橡胶基抗冲击吸收材料和 0.1-10 份质量的改性烯烃蜡。该树脂组合物符合以下要求 (I)-(III)。(I) 氯乙烯树脂的氯含量为 55-75%(按质量计)。(II) 橡胶基抗冲击吸收材料 (B) 的差示扫描量热法玻璃化温度 (Tg) 为 0°C 或更低。(III) 改性烯烃蜡含有至少一个选自卤素和羧酸衍生物的极性基团,且极性基团含量在 0.1-50% (质量百分比)范围内。
